Subject: Re: [PATCH v2] qtnfmac: Fix possible buffer overflow in qtnf_event_handle_external_auth
Date: Thu, 22 Apr 2021 14:40:55 +0000 (UTC)	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20210422144055.3613EC433D3@smtp.codeaurora.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20210419145842.345787-1-leegib@gmail.com>

Lee Gibson <leegib@gmail.com> wrote:

> Function qtnf_event_handle_external_auth calls memcpy without
> checking the length.
> A user could control that length and trigger a buffer overflow.
> Fix by checking the length is within the maximum allowed size.
> 
> Signed-off-by: Lee Gibson <leegib@gmail.com>

Patch applied to wireless-drivers-next.git, thanks.

130f634da1af qtnfmac: Fix possible buffer overflow in qtnf_event_handle_external_auth
